Abstract
A rapid, simple, and accurate method for the determination of kanamycin and dibekacin in serum by use of high-pressure liquid chromatography is described. The serum proteins were precipitated with 3.5% perchloric acid containing sodium octanesulfonate. After centrifugation, a sample of the supernatant was directly injected into the chromatograph. The determination of kanamycin and dibekacin was performed by a combination of reverse-phase, ion-pair chromatography, postcolumn derivatization with o-phthalaldehyde, and fluorescence detection. The correlation coefficients with fluorescence polarization immunoassay were 0.996 for kanamycin and 0.957 for dibekacin.Entities:
